Morena maintains a dominant position in Guerrero heading into the 2027 gubernatorial election, with party identification near 50-60% in recent surveys, far ahead of the PRI and smaller parties. Beatriz Mojica Morga leads Morena internal preferences at roughly 33% in mid-2026 polling, ahead of Esthela Damián Peralta, reflecting stronger name recognition and opinion balances, while Manuel Añorve Baños tops PRI options. Trader consensus shows these two as the closest contenders because nomination processes remain fluid, opposition support is fragmented across multiple parties, and a large share of voters stay undecided more than a year out. Shifts in Morena's candidate selection or broader coalition dynamics could widen separations before voting.

This market will resolve according to the listed candidate who wins the 2027 Guerrero gubernatorial elections. Any interim or caretaker Governor will not qualify.
If the results are not known definitively by December 31, 2027, 11:59 PM ET, this market will resolve to “Other”.
This market will resolve based on the results of this election, as indicated by a consensus of credible reporting. If there is ambiguity, this market will resolve solely based on official results as reported by government sources of Guerrero and Mexico, including the Electoral Institute of Guerrero and the National Electoral Institute of Mexico.
